Kazuo Hayashi is a scholar working on Food Science, Plant Science and Molecular Biology. According to data from OpenAlex, Kazuo Hayashi has authored 87 papers receiving a total of 997 indexed citations (citations by other indexed papers that have themselves been cited), including 20 papers in Food Science, 14 papers in Plant Science and 13 papers in Molecular Biology. Recurrent topics in Kazuo Hayashi’s work include Food Quality and Safety Studies (14 papers), Biochemical Analysis and Sensing Techniques (7 papers) and Fermentation and Sensory Analysis (6 papers). Kazuo Hayashi is often cited by papers focused on Food Quality and Safety Studies (14 papers), Biochemical Analysis and Sensing Techniques (7 papers) and Fermentation and Sensory Analysis (6 papers). Kazuo Hayashi collaborates with scholars based in Japan, United States and South Korea. Kazuo Hayashi's co-authors include Izumi Yajima, Hidemasa Sakakibara, Yôichi Sugioka, Tetsuya Yanai, Mikio Nakamura, Kazuhide Uenoyama, Noburu Ishinishi, Kazuyuki Takamura, Norio Matsukura and Gorô Asano and has published in prestigious journals such as Biomaterials, Cancer and Journal of Materials Science.
